Setting Materials: Adhesives and Mortars

The material that bonds tile to a surface is called the setting material. Choosing the right one depends on your tile type, substrate, and installation environment.

  • Thinset mortar: A cement-based adhesive mixed with water or a liquid latex additive. It's the standard choice for most tile installations, especially in wet areas like showers and floors. Available in gray and white; white is preferred under light-colored grout or glass tile.
  • Modified thinset: Thinset with polymer additives that improve flexibility and bond strength. Required for large-format tile and porcelain.
  • Mastic: An organic, premixed adhesive sold ready to use. Convenient for dry, interior wall applications — but it softens when exposed to moisture, making it unsuitable for showers or floors.
  • Epoxy mortar: A two-part system combining resin and hardener. Extremely durable and chemical-resistant; used in commercial kitchens and industrial settings. Harder to work with and more expensive than standard thinset.
  • Medium-bed mortar: A thicker thinset formulation designed for large or heavy tiles where a standard thinset bed would slump or sag.

Thinset mortar

A cement-based adhesive used to bond tile to a substrate. It is available in standard and polymer-modified ("modified") versions, with modified thinset offering greater bond strength and flexibility.

Back-buttering

Spreading a thin layer of thinset directly onto the back of a tile before pressing it into the mortar bed. This improves adhesion coverage, especially for large-format or natural stone tiles.

Grout joint

The intentional gap left between tiles during installation, later filled with grout. Joint width affects both aesthetics and the choice of grout type — sanded vs. unsanded.

Substrate

The surface layer onto which tile is installed. Common substrates include cement board, concrete slabs, and uncoupling membranes. The substrate must be flat, stable, and appropriate for the tile and environment.

Lippage

A height difference between the edges of adjacent tiles, creating an uneven surface. Caused by substrate irregularities, inconsistent mortar beds, or tile warpage, and can be a trip hazard on floors.

Uncoupling membrane

A thin, flexible layer installed between the substrate and tile that absorbs structural movement. It helps prevent tile cracking caused by substrate flex, especially over wood subfloors.

Rectified tile

Tile that has been mechanically cut to precise, uniform dimensions after kiln firing. Enables tighter grout joints and more consistent layouts than non-rectified tile.

Grout sealer

A penetrating or topical liquid applied to cured cement-based grout to resist staining and moisture infiltration. Epoxy and urethane grouts typically do not require sealing.

Grout: Types, Uses, and Joint Sizing

Grout fills the joints between tiles after they're set. The right grout type depends almost entirely on the width of your tile joints.

  • Sanded grout: Contains fine sand filler; used for joints wider than 1/8 inch. The sand prevents shrinkage cracking in wider gaps. Avoid using sanded grout on polished stone — the sand can scratch the surface.
  • Unsanded grout (non-sanded): A smooth cement-based grout for joints 1/16 to 1/8 inch wide. Preferred for glass tile, polished marble, and narrow mosaic joints.
  • Epoxy grout: Highly stain- and chemical-resistant; does not require sealing. More difficult to apply and clean up. A strong choice for kitchen countertops and commercial environments.
  • Urethane grout: A premixed, flexible grout that resists staining and doesn't require sealing. Easier to apply than epoxy but at a higher cost than cement-based grouts.
  • Grout haze: The thin film of dried grout residue left on the tile face after grouting. Removed with a damp sponge while fresh, or a grout haze remover once cured.

Always Seal Cement-Based Grout

Cement-based grouts — both sanded and unsanded — are porous and will absorb stains from cooking oils, wine, and cleaning products if left unsealed. Allow grout to cure fully (typically 72 hours minimum) before applying a penetrating grout sealer. Epoxy and urethane grouts are inherently non-porous and do not require sealing.

Substrates, Tools, and Key Layout Terms

The substrate is the surface you're tiling over. Tile can only perform as well as what's underneath it.

  • Cement board (backerboard): A rigid panel made of cement and fiberglass mesh. The standard substrate for wet areas — it won't swell or deteriorate from moisture the way drywall does.
  • Drywall (greenboard): Moisture-resistant drywall sometimes used in low-moisture wall applications. Not appropriate for showers or steam environments.
  • Uncoupling membrane: A thin, lightweight plastic layer installed between the substrate and tile. It isolates tile from structural movement, reducing the risk of cracking — particularly valuable over in-floor heating or wood subfloors.
  • Notched trowel: The tool used to apply and comb thinset into ridges that help tile bond properly. Trowel size (V-notch, U-notch, square-notch) should match tile size — larger tiles require deeper notches.
  • Lippage: Uneven tile edges where one tile sits higher than its neighbor. Minimized by proper substrate preparation, consistent mortar coverage, and leveling clips.
  • Rectified tile: Tile that has been precisely cut after firing to achieve uniform dimensions. Allows for tighter grout joints (as narrow as 1/16 inch).
  • Layout lines / chalk lines: Reference lines snapped across the substrate before setting begins, ensuring tiles are installed square and centered to the room.

≥95%

Required mortar contact coverage in wet areas

According to the Tile Council of North America (TCNA) Handbook, wet and exterior tile installations require at least 95% mortar contact on the tile back to prevent moisture infiltration and bond failure.

72 hrs

Minimum grout cure time before sealing

Most cement-based grout manufacturers recommend waiting at least 72 hours after grouting before applying a sealer, though longer cure times may apply in humid or cold conditions.

1/8"

Typical minimum grout joint for floor tile

The TCNA Handbook identifies 1/8 inch as a common minimum joint width for standard floor tile installations, helping accommodate slight size variations between tiles.
